  • Dec 31, 2008, 10:41 AM
    seahwk83

    That prgram PC optimizer is not for cleaning viruses, it is used to clean and optimize your registry and clean up unneeded files found on your system and is not free, once you run the program, it checks your system and when it asks you if you would like to fix errors it finds, you will be prompted to purchase the software and right now the price is 9.99 for a 9 month license

    There are a lot of sites that will search you PC for viruses, but to remove them you will usually be prompted to purchase something.

    This from MS is free
    Malicious Software Removal Tool

    The avira is free

    Here is another free antivirus that is avail - ClamWin
    Free Antivirus for Windows - Open source GPL virus scanner
